Job Summary And Qualifications What you will do in this role: Work in a customer-centric transfer and transport call center; respond to all callers with the aid of an electronic database of service profiles, approved clinical protocols and healthcare information. Work collaboratively with team members ensuring appropriate patient admission. Exhibit proficiency in EMTALA. Efficiently and effectively, manage all hospital transfers and transports. Display and model exceptional customer relationship behaviors, including telephone and personal contact with all of the call center’s customer groups (i.e. physicians and their office staffs, callers, and fellow employees). Exhibit knowledge of all state/federal regulatory requirements pertaining to ambulance transportsDisplay exceptional communication and interpersonal skills with physicians and their offices to coordinate admission. What qualifications you will need: EMT Certificate (required)Minimum 2 years of clinical or hospital experience required – highly preferred ED and acute hospital experienceCall Center/Transfer Center experience (preferred) Scheduling Requirements: 12 Hour Shifts – RequiredFlexibility in scheduling - RequiredRotating Weekends - RequiredHoliday Shifts - Required Benefits Medical City Plano, offers a total rewards package that supports the health, life, career and retirement of our colleagues. Parallon provides full-service revenue cycle management, or total patient account resolution, for HCA Healthcare. Our services include scheduling, registration, insurance verification, hospital billing, revenue integrity, collections, payment compliance, credentialing, health information management, customer service, payroll, and physician billing. We also provide full-service revenue cycle management as well as targeted solutions, such as Medicaid Eligibility, for external clients across the country. Parallon has over 17,000 colleagues, and serves close to 1,000 hospitals and 3,000 physician practices, all making an impact on patients, providers, and their communities.
